1use std::collections::HashMap;
2
3use serde_json::{Map, Number, Value};
4
5use crate::generators::{self as gs, BoxedGenerator, DefaultGenerator, Generator};
6
7use super::{NumberGenerator, ValueGenerator, numbers, values};
8
9impl DefaultGenerator for Number {
10    type Generator = NumberGenerator;
11    fn default_generator() -> Self::Generator {
12        numbers()
13    }
14}
15
16impl DefaultGenerator for Value {
17    type Generator = ValueGenerator;
18    fn default_generator() -> Self::Generator {
19        values()
20    }
21}
22
23// `serde_json::Map<K, V>` is generic in its type signature, but every public
24// constructor and trait impl is hardcoded to `Map<String, Value>`. There's no
25// way to construct any other instantiation through the crate's public API,
26// so this impl covers the full usable space.
27impl DefaultGenerator for Map<String, Value> {
28    type Generator = BoxedGenerator<'static, Map<String, Value>>;
29    fn default_generator() -> Self::Generator {
30        gs::hashmaps(
31            <String as DefaultGenerator>::default_generator(),
32            <Value as DefaultGenerator>::default_generator(),
33        )
34        .map(|m: HashMap<String, Value>| m.into_iter().collect::<Map<String, Value>>())
35        .boxed()
36    }
37}
38
39#[cfg(feature = "serde_json_raw_value")]
40impl DefaultGenerator for Box<serde_json::value::RawValue> {
41    type Generator = super::RawValueGenerator;
42    fn default_generator() -> Self::Generator {
43        super::raw_values()
44    }
